Pitted keratolysis. pitted keratolysis is a bacterial infection that affects the skin on your feet. the condition causes a foul odor and itchiness. you’re most at risk if you have sweaty feet and wear shoes that don’t offer adequate airflow. antibiotics treat the infection to remove the bacteria from your body. Skin sensitivity: if your teen has sensitive skin, it’s best to start with gentle, fragrance free, and aluminum free deodorants. patch testing a new product on a small area of skin before use is always a good idea. activity level: highly active teens will likely benefit from an antiperspirant to help control sweat.

Use a cotton ball to apply a small amount of rubbing alcohol to your feet every night. this will help to dry out your feet. avoid applying it to any cracks in your skin. apply an antifungal foot. Disinfect your shoes – a general purpose disinfectant spray will help remove odor from the shoe. use a spray that contains ethanol, which kills bacteria. remove the insole from the shoe and spray it. let the insole dry for 24 hours before returning it to the footwear. use a powder – if you have an abundance of foot sweat, an over the.
